@media screen {
body { 
	margin:0;
	padding:0;
	font-size:1em;
	font-family:arial,sans-serif;
}
body { text-align:left;} 
#testa {width:100%;text-align:left;margin:0;height:154px}
#testa form, #testa p, #testa fieldset {margin:0;padding:0;border:0}
#titolo {display:none}
#logo {float:left;border:0;margin-bottom;display:block;height:153px;width:179px}
#portali {}
#logo a img, #logo img {border:0}
#piedipagina {width:100%; text-align:left;}
#banner1 {
/*width:17.4em;*/
float:right;
text-align:right;
width:480px;
height:60px;
overflow:hidden
}
#menu_or {clear:right;height:20px;margin-bottom:5px}
#menu_or p {padding:5px 0 0 0;margin:0;font-size:80%;}
#menu_or p a {text-decoration:none;display:block;float:left;padding:0 0.45em}
#menu_or p a:hover {text-decoration:underline}
#menu_or .separe {display:none}
#ricerca {float:left;padding-top:5px}
#parola {width:135px}
#ricerca p {font-size:80%;margin:0;padding:0 0 0.1em 0.5em}
#cerca_siti {margin-left:2.8em}
#ricerca a {text-decoration:none;}
#banner2 {float:right;width:280px;height:60px;text-align:right}
#left {float:left;width:19%;margin-right:0.8%;min-width:6em;padding-bottom:0.5em}
#cleft {float:left;width:29.2%;margin-right:0.5%}
#cright {float:left;width:29.5%;margin-right:0.5%}
#right {float:right;width:19.7%;min-width:7em;padding-bottom:1em}
#cleft.centro {width:59%;margin-right:0}
#cleft.centro p {padding:0.2em 0;margin:0;}
#cleft.centro p.scheda {text-align:right}
.foto {margin:1em}
.link {margin:0;border:0}
#piedipagina {text-align:center}
#piedipagina p {font-size:0.80em}
#piedipagina p a {text-decoration:none}
#left p, #left ul, #right p, #right ul, #cleft p, #cleft ul, #cright p, #cright ul {font-size:80%}
#left p, #right p {margin:0;padding:0.2em 0.2em}
#left h1, #right h1, #cleft h1, #cright h1  {font-size:1em;margin-bottom:0;}
#left h2, #right h2, #cleft h2, #cright h2  {font-size:0.8em;font-style:italic;margin:0.5em 0 0.2em 0;padding:0 0.2em}
#left h3, #right h3, #cleft h3, #cright h3  {font-size:0.8em;font-weight:normal;font-style:italic}
#cleft h1, #cright h1  {font-size:1em;padding:0 13px 0 0.1em}
#right form, #right fieldset {border:0 solid black;margin:0;padding:0}
#right form p, #right fieldset p {padding:0;margin:0.1em 0.2em}
#left p a, #left ul a, #right p a, #right ul a, #cleft p a, #cleft ul a, #cright p a, #cright ul a {text-decoration:none}
#cleft.centro a {font-style:italic}
#cleft.centro ul a {font-style:normal}
#left p a:hover, #left ul a:hover, #right p a:hover, #right ul a:hover, #cleft p a:hover, #cleft ul a:hover, #cright p a:hover, #cright ul a:hover {text-decoration:underline}
#left h1,#right h1  {text-align:center;margin-top:0}
#cright ul, #cleft ul{margin-left:1.3em;padding-left:0}
#cright .archivi, #cleft .archivi {text-align:right}
#cright .foto, #cleft .foto {margin: 0 1em 0 0;float:left;border:0}
#login1, #login2, #aziende {text-align:right;padding-bottom:0.5em; margin-bottom:0.5em;}
#cleft p, #cright p {padding: 0 0.5em}
#cleft.centro form label {display:block;float:left;width:200px;border-bottom:1px solid gray;padding-bottom:4px}
#cleft #googy a {display:normal;float:left;color:yellow}
table {font-size:80%}
#cleft ul, #cright ul {margin:0.5em 0 0 16px}
#cleft.centro p {clear:left}
#cleft.centro a img {border:0}
#cleft th {text-align:left}
#cleft ol li {font-size:80%}
#right ul li, #left ul li {line-height:14px;margin:2px 0}
#right ul, #left ul {margin:0.5em 0 0 16px;padding:0;text-align:left}
#cleft ol li a {text-decoration:none}
table.forum {border-collapse:collapse}
table.forum a {text-decoration:none}
table.forum td {padding:0.3em}
#menu_interno {background: #C7C7C7 url(images/sfondo_sottomenu.png) top repeat-x;height:20px;border-bottom:1px solid black}
#menu_interno p {}
#cleft.centro #menu_interno a, #menu_interno span.corrente {text-decoration:none;font-style:normal;color:#333;display:block;float:left;padding:0 5px;border-left:1px solid white;border-right: 1px solid black}
#cleft.centro #menu_interno a:hover, #menu_interno span.corrente {background:white;color:gray}
#cleft.centro table.dati {border-collapse:collapse;width:50%}
#cleft.centro table.doppio {width:100%}
#cleft.centro table.dati th {text-align:center}
#cleft.centro table.dati td {border:1px solid gray;padding: 0 1em}
#cleft.centro table.dati td.numero {text-align:right}
#link_art {float:left;}
#link_art a img {border:0}
#left img {border:0}
#right #consulenza p {font-size:70%}
#right #consulenza p a {color:red;font-weight:bold}
.cellulari {display:none}
}
@media handheld {
body {font-size:70%;background:white;color:black}
#logo, #portali, #mappaitalia {display:none}
}
@media print {
body {color:red}
}
